Address 0 PPC

P95ddut5qEYoV9bQLG3EZfY1VFBzmgyvbz

Confirmed

Total Received0.079803 PPC
Total Sent0.079803 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
714086 Confirmations10.069803 PPC
Fee: 0.01 PPC
714087 Confirmations22.090803 PPC